diff options
author | Diego Elio Pettenò <flameeyes@gentoo.org> | 2012-08-12 20:51:39 +0000 |
---|---|---|
committer | Diego Elio Pettenò <flameeyes@gentoo.org> | 2012-08-12 20:51:39 +0000 |
commit | 104c23f59a8af2ec6fb68bdec7e83feb8f6d97f1 (patch) | |
tree | cab8cec4542845c08711f8f01c7e4d715971ee5f /dev-ruby/rack-test/rack-test-0.6.1.ebuild | |
parent | Bump to EAPI 4 and use the new rspec recipe for testing instead of rake. (diff) | |
download | gentoo-2-104c23f59a8af2ec6fb68bdec7e83feb8f6d97f1.tar.gz gentoo-2-104c23f59a8af2ec6fb68bdec7e83feb8f6d97f1.tar.bz2 gentoo-2-104c23f59a8af2ec6fb68bdec7e83feb8f6d97f1.zip |
Bump to EAPI 4; use the new rspec recipe for testing, and stop using bundler (these last two let the test work instead of failing on a missing diff/lcs).
(Portage version: 2.2.0_alpha120/cvs/Linux x86_64)
Diffstat (limited to 'dev-ruby/rack-test/rack-test-0.6.1.ebuild')
-rw-r--r-- | dev-ruby/rack-test/rack-test-0.6.1.ebuild | 12 |
1 files changed, 7 insertions, 5 deletions
diff --git a/dev-ruby/rack-test/rack-test-0.6.1.ebuild b/dev-ruby/rack-test/rack-test-0.6.1.ebuild index eadb7058e342..15140f936f8f 100644 --- a/dev-ruby/rack-test/rack-test-0.6.1.ebuild +++ b/dev-ruby/rack-test/rack-test-0.6.1.ebuild @@ -1,14 +1,14 @@ # Copyright 1999-2012 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/dev-ruby/rack-test/rack-test-0.6.1.ebuild,v 1.4 2012/03/11 14:14:04 ranger Exp $ +# $Header: /var/cvsroot/gentoo-x86/dev-ruby/rack-test/rack-test-0.6.1.ebuild,v 1.5 2012/08/12 20:51:39 flameeyes Exp $ -EAPI=2 +EAPI=4 USE_RUBY="ruby18 ruby19 ree18" # no documentation is generable, it needs hanna, which is broken RUBY_FAKEGEM_TASK_DOC="" -RUBY_FAKEGEM_TASK_TEST="spec" +RUBY_FAKEGEM_RECIPE_TEST="rspec" RUBY_FAKEGEM_EXTRADOC="History.txt README.rdoc" @@ -23,8 +23,10 @@ KEYWORDS="~amd64 ~ppc64 ~x86 ~amd64-linux ~x86-linux ~ppc-macos ~x64-macos ~x86- IUSE="" ruby_add_rdepend '>=dev-ruby/rack-1.0' -ruby_add_bdepend "test? ( dev-ruby/rspec:2 dev-ruby/bundler >=dev-ruby/sinatra-1.2.6 )" +ruby_add_bdepend " + test? ( >=dev-ruby/sinatra-1.2.6 )" all_ruby_prepare() { - rm Gemfile.lock + rm Gemfile* || die + sed -i -e '/bundler/d' spec/spec_helper.rb || die } |